Hallandale Beach commission approves 15-story Hallandale Hotel with parking and setback waivers
Summary
The Hallandale Beach City Commission unanimously approved a major development plan and redevelopment-area modifications for a proposed 15-story, 246-room Hallandale Hotel at 804 S. Federal Highway, allowing several variances tied to an undersized adjacent street and approving associated conditions in the resolution.
The Hallandale Beach City Commission unanimously approved a major development plan and related redevelopment-area modifications on March 19, allowing construction of a 15‑story, dual‑branded hotel at 804 South Federal Highway.
The developer, represented by attorney Rachel Streitfeld and architect Meyer Abbo, asked for waivers from multiple zoning requirements tied to site constraints, including setbacks above the fifth floor and pedestrian-walkway dimension rules. The project calls for 246 guest rooms, a landscaped civic plaza with public-facing amenities and 193 parking spaces screened behind an active street-level liner.
